IGNOU. Its really a good head-ache now, i am in last semester but frustrated from the process. None of the faculty member from your regional center as well as study centre will help you to answer yours queries. You have to suppose everything at your own and act accordingly. If you ask anything regarding your assignment submission as well as lab courses, your study centre will simply say to ask it from regional centre. And our great regional centres Coming to projects, sometimes in viva they will say reply should be like this. Next time when you will submit the report as per instruction, some other superintendent will be there to reject it again and to instruct to format it as it was earlier. Campus placements are available for all semesters but the offers are more the students in third year. The offers came form many reputed companies like Deloitte, EY, NSDC and more. The highest packages offered were 24 LPA. Almost 75 to 80 percent students got the campus placement. I did not sit for the placement as I was beginning my preparation for UPSC.
